Cheapest Pet Friendly Apartment Rentals in Lincoln Park, NJ

The lowest priced Lincoln Park apartment at a property that allows pets is the 1 bedroom 1 Bed Model at Kings Arms Garden Apartments in the Preakness neighborhood starting from $1,900. The second cheapest Lincoln Park Pet Friendly apartment is the 55+ Studio Model at The VIEW at Fairfield, which is a Studio starting at $2,000 in the Estates at Hilltop neighborhood. Frequently Asked Questions about Lincoln Park

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Lincoln Park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Lincoln Park ranges from $1,550 to $4,784 with an average monthly rent of $2,576.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Lincoln Park c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Lincoln Park range from $2,150 to $6,896.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,357.
